About Acebrophylline-Sustained Release-Fexofenadine HCL And Montelukast Tablets



Acebrophylline-Sustained Release-Fexofenadine HCL And Montelukast Tablets are designed to provide effective relief from respiratory conditions and allergic symptoms. These general medicines come in tablet form and leverage the combined benefits of Acebrophylline, Fexofenadine HCL, and Montelukast. Formulated for sustained release, they help manage conditions such as asthma, bronchitis, and allergic rhinitis by improving airflow, reducing inflammation, and controlling allergy triggers. The product is packaged in boxes containing 10 x 10 tablets, ensuring convenience for bulk usage or distribution. To maintain optimal quality, the tablets should be stored in a dry place. Dosage should strictly follow the guidance of a healthcare professional, ensuring safe and effective use. Manufactured for quality and reliability, these tablets are a powerful solution for respiratory and allergic health concerns.
